Common Plumbing Tasks and Methods

Local plumbers in Dayton, Ohio, are equipped to handle a variety of common plumbing challenges. For instance, addressing persistent drips from faucets might involve replacing worn-out washers or cartridges, a relatively straightforward repair. More complex tasks, such as resolving recurring drain blockages, often require specialized tools like drain snakes or hydro-jetting equipment to clear stubborn obstructions. In older homes, pipe replacement might be necessary due to corrosion or outdated materials, with modern plumbers often utilizing durable PEX or copper piping.

Water heater issues are another frequent service request. Whether it’s a need for repair for an aging unit or a full replacement with a more energy-efficient model, local experts understand the different types of water heaters and can recommend the best fit for your household’s needs and Dayton’s climate. Sewer line repairs, which can be caused by tree roots or age, often involve trenchless technology for minimal disruption, a method favored by many contemporary plumbing businesses.

Q2 What kind of plumbing issues are common in Dayton’s older homes?

Dayton’s historic homes, particularly in neighborhoods like the Oregon District, can experience plumbing issues related to aging infrastructure. This might include lead or galvanized steel pipes that are prone to corrosion, leading to leaks or reduced water pressure. Tree root intrusion into sewer lines can also be a concern in older areas with mature landscaping. Modern plumbers are experienced in addressing these specific challenges with appropriate repair and replacement techniques.

For Plumber in Dayton, Ohio, local conditions affect the job. A large share of homes in Dayton were built around 1950, which typically means galvanized steel supply lines — which corrode over time, restricting water pressure and water quality in ways that are easy to mistake for other problems. In Dayton's climate, pipe freezing and bursts are a real winter risk — particularly for pipes in exterior walls or unheated crawl spaces.

Do I need a licensed plumber in Dayton?

Minor repairs are often DIY-able, but anything touching the main line, gas connections, permits, or interior walls should go to a licensed plumber.

Is my Dayton landlord responsible for this plumbing issue?

If you rent in Dayton: Ohio's habitability standards generally require landlords to maintain functioning plumbing — a broken pipe, failed water heater, or sewer backup is the landlord's responsibility to fix promptly.

Montgomery County Water Quality: Very Hard Water

Water sampled across Montgomery County averages 305 mg/L of calcium-magnesium hardness — classified as very hard water. At 305 mg/L, scale buildup affects fixtures, water heaters, and appliance inlets county-wide — annual water heater flushing and periodic aerator cleaning are cost-effective maintenance steps, and many homes here benefit from a whole-house softener. Source: U.S. Environmental Protection Agency, Water Quality Portal — Hardness (Ca/Mg) measurements aggregated by county.
